California Quail Chick

Southern Vancouver Island

Mamma brought her chicks out and there were eight in all. Herding cats may be difficult, but it doesn't hold a candle to eight quail chicks who have just discovered the miracle of flight! Mama was a busy bird. We were amazed that chicks this small could fly at all, but these babies could make it from the ground into the trees with no problem! California Quail facts: California Quail chicks are precocial, which means relatively mature and mobile from the moment of hatching, so can leave the nest with their parents. ~ whatbird.com
